Design outcomes

Primary

MeasureTime frame
The primary study parameter is the functional immune response (ratio pro- and anti-inflammatory markers) measured in isolated PBMCs, collected at 0 hours (baseline), 4 hours, and 8 hours after consumption of the omega-3-rich supplements, and after 1-week exposure to the supplements.

Secondary

MeasureTime frame
The secondary study parameters are the DHA levels in blood and fatty acid levels in plasma and PBMCs, taken before and after the consumption of omega-3-rich supplements.
